Read MoreAptly named after the first programmer, Ada Lovelace, the Ada Developers Academy is a women-only coding bootcamp in downtown Seattle. The full-stack web development bootcamp consists of six months of training followed by five months of paid internship. Ada's purpose is to bring greater diversity to the technology sector by equipping women and gender-diverse students with the support, skills, and experience needed to become professional software engineers that contribute to the future of software. The Ada curriculum covers Ruby, HTML, CSS, Sinatra, Rails, Javascript, and Web API Development in an Agile software development environment. Students also learn leadership and inclusion, CS fundamentals, pair programming, networking, and career readiness skills. Read More

Read MoreAda Developers Academy ( ADA ) delivers what it says it does. You will receive a top notch education in programming, computer science fundamentals, and preparation for whiteboard style interviewing. You will not be charged tuition and you will receive a stipend at the end of each month of your internship that is the equivalent of 35 hours a week at $15 an hour. Taxes will not be taken out of your check as your role is that of a contractor. Most of your class will have job offers before the cohort ends, but not all, often for reasons not under ADA's ( or the Adies' ) control. You will graduate ready to enter the job market as a junior developer. You will think that you should feel more skilled and experienced once you reach that point but you won't ( what you hope to feel like usually takes 5 years of experience and work to achieve ). You will have a strong network of graduates to lean on and the support of ADA during future job searches and dealing with the challenges that the tech industry brings.
Teaching will usually be spot on, but there will be missteps and errors along the way. You will be doing more independent study than you anticipate. Your instructors ( 2 per 24 students, 1 floating instructor, 1 Jumpstart instructor, a dedicated Computer Science Fundamentals instructor, and an outstanding student counselor ) are supportive, committed to the mission of ADA, and eager for you to succeed, but they are human. Things more very fast and you have to advocate for yourself and your classmates. Sometimes tutoring is available, sometimes not. If you start to fall behind you need to recognize it quickly and get assistance immediately. You may have to go outside of ADA to do that.
You will receive education and training about social justice, including the concerns and challenges of women of color and non-binary individuals. You will be personally be challenged. You will learn things you didn't know about yourself, and didn't necessarily want to know. You will learn that there is difference between ADA and the Adies alumnix. It was the alumnix who made the commitment to "no woman left behind". Students have been expelled from ADA. Not all of us got in on our first try. Some were admitted on their 5th try. There is some Redshirting. You will form some of the strongest friendships of your life, but you won't like everyone. Lateral aggression is minimal, bullying almost non-existent. ADA was worth it, the Adies especially so. But it is hard. The process hurts. It hurts alot. But it was worth it. Eyes open, keep your expectations in check, and it will be amazing. You will be amazing. Apply.

Read MoreThe bootcamp simulates a software development team that is working on a project based on a real life scenario. All participants will form a SCRUM team and experiece a full cycle of a software project. They will experience SCRUM meetings and tackles all the project complexities that grow as the project progress.I learned a lot. Not only programming skills (frameworks, tools, best practices, testing, design patterns, etc). but also how to work as a team. Since programming is a team sport, I believe it is very important to be able to integrate to an existing team. The participant will be evaluated as a team and as an individual.Unfortunately the bootcamp is not for people with 0 knowledge about programming. The bootcamp will not teach you how to create an array or a list in Java. But it will transform people with programming knowledge to be a software developer.I am glad that I took my chance to join the bootcamp and leave my country for an adventure in Germany. Now I am starting my new career as a softwareentwicker in Munich. Everything that I learned are being used in my current project. Top Interns

Read MoreSpreadsheets sparked my career in software development. I spent a lot of time working in them in my last job and loved the logical gymnastics of using a combination of values and formulas to create tools to help my team work more efficiently. That said, as the spreadsheet tools I created became more complex, I became hungrier to break free of the constraints of cells and execute logic in clearer, more advanced ways—and with a nicer interface too.This lead me to coding. I was mindblown by how many great online resources there were to learn how to code for free… or more accurately, I was overwhelmed. As someone entering the field for the first time, I didn’t even know where to start. Let alone what I would need to be capable of to be competitive in the job market. Fortunately, I stumbled across the Coding Boot Camp at the University of Sydney and quickly knew it was the perfect course for me.I think this will be the perfect course for you too, if you’re someone who:- Wants a comprehensive understanding of how to build a website
- Craves structure to stay motivated
- And, is excited to learn a lot in a short time.
There are ~12 hours of lectures per week, across three evenings (if you’re based in Sydney). This means that you can do the course whilst working full-time. I’ve been amazed by how much I can achieve in the evenings, a time that I previously underutilised. That said, working full-time and taking this course is hard, to the point where you probably won't be able to get as much out of it compared to if you were working part-time or taking a break from work. This is because the course is quite fast-paced. To break it down:- The course is 24 weeks long, with no weeks off in between.
- Each week, we cover around 15 new concepts related to a particular area of the field.
- For each concept, the instructor runs through a demonstration. Then, you go into a breakout room with other students and a tutor and you directly apply what you’ve learnt to an activity.
- There is a new assignment every week. You can only skip two assignments to pass the course.
- Class attendance is mandatory and your camera needs to be on. You can only miss up to eight classes to pass the course.
Personally, I find this structure very motivating. It’s why I love the course so much. It keeps me accountable and continuously pushes me to keep learning. Looking back over the last three months, I am astounded by how much I have learned—there is absolutely no way I could have made so much progress on my own in such a short time.I also love how personable and supportive the course is. Learning independently online seems bleak in comparison. The instructor and teaching assistants responsible for delivering my course are incredibly clear and knowledgeable. Our instructor is particularly motivating and regularly reminds us of how far we've come and where we can find extra support if needed. There’s a 24/7 chat-based service where you can ask for help with your code. Pretty much 100% of the time, I get the help I need to solve my problem within 15 minutes. You can also opt-in for 1:1 tutoring sessions on top of regular classes if you need them. Overall, I feel like there are so many opportunities for extra support.
I haven't really started my job search yet, so I can't comment too thoroughly on the career services. That said, I feel confident that I'm learning the right concepts to be employer-competitive and that when I'm ready to start applying, there are resources there for me to prepare for interviews, write my application materials and have them reviewed to increase my chances of success.If I'm being picky, my only critiques are:- Sometimes the feedback on my assignments feels a little generic/templated. That said, it’s far more feedback than I ever received on an assignment in my undergraduate degree. Also, I think it reflects one of my favourite things about coding—if you hit all of the acceptance criteria, then your work is good enough and perhaps there isn’t much more that needs to be said.
- I wish there were more opportunities to network, both in person and online, with people in the course and outside of it. I think they could do more to help us meet people working in the industry.
- A week off in the middle of the course would be nice.
If you choose to enrol in this course, my advice is just that you’ll get out what you put in. If you want to get the most out of it, be prepared to be challenged. Ultimately, your coding abilities are what matter. Not your assignment marks or your attendance—so try to come into this with the mindset that everything you do is adding to your potential success.
TLDR: the course is challenging, but you are guaranteed to learn.... Read Less Hack Academy
